Ordinals
beta
Sat 711010787661506
decimal
142202.787661506
degree
0°142202′1082″787661506‴
percentile
33.85765659255325%
name
iuuizgdxrhv
cycle
0
epoch
0
period
70
block
142202
offset
787661506
timestamp
2011-08-23 05:55:27 UTC
rarity
common
prev
next